Description

DESCRIPTION OF ASTON CLINTON PARSONAGE TIME OF SR.PETER WALDO (1716-1745)(B1).
MAPS & LOCAL INFO SHOW OLD RECTORY STOOD SE OF LATER RECTORY. SITE LATER KITCHEN GARDENS OF ASTON CLINTON HOUSE. THE LATER RECTORY WAS BUILT DURING INCUMBENCY OF REV J GEORGE (1799-1847) USING MATERIALS FROM OLD RECTORY (B2).
